Output 561a24ece3b2d1bc5f34e59714b6b6d176d45a3c81b37d0cd97398656a9487b7:3

value
424340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d2f05535abc3f4d1e4b0cd7488b5e40e2f2412e OP_EQUAL
address
3JwKxryJTZBEKL5d1AUTEs43FNGeuc2qcz
transaction
561a24ece3b2d1bc5f34e59714b6b6d176d45a3c81b37d0cd97398656a9487b7
confirmations
172854
spent
true